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/sqlite/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
插入值时发生SQLite数据库错误_Sql_Sqlite - Fatal编程技术网

插入值时发生SQLite数据库错误

插入值时发生SQLite数据库错误,sql,sqlite,Sql,Sqlite,如您所见,我正在创建一个表la_table并插入cetain值。我得到了这个错误没有这样的专栏:“Serum”。我真的很困惑。我试图在test\u type\u 1列中插入“Serum”,而不是“Serum”这似乎是您引用的问题。血清周围的“不是标准的 尝试使用单引号 插入la_表值(1,'Na','310-330 mg/dl',空值,'Serum','1')我不能这样做,我需要在值中使用'。我如何转义'?将它们加倍,例如字符串不能那样做将作为'不能那样做'插入。这是OpenOffice的一个恼

如您所见,我正在创建一个表
la_table
并插入cetain值。我得到了这个错误
没有这样的专栏:“Serum”
。我真的很困惑。我试图在
test\u type\u 1
列中插入“Serum”,而不是
“Serum”

这似乎是您引用的问题。
血清周围的
不是标准的

尝试使用单引号


插入la_表值(1,'Na','310-330 mg/dl',空值,'Serum','1')

我不能这样做,我需要在值中使用
'
。我如何转义
'
?将它们加倍,例如字符串
不能那样做
将作为
'不能那样做'
插入。这是OpenOffice的一个恼人的功能。OO使用“而不是”(我正在使用OO编辑数据库)。刚刚替换了它们,现在就可以了。我会接受你的答案,因为我看到了你的答案。谢谢。顺便说一句,SQLite处理双引号很好。
12-31 23:21:15.285: I/System.out(1609): onCreate SQL
12-31 23:21:15.535: I/System.out(1609): CREATE TABLE IF NOT EXISTS la_table (
12-31 23:21:15.535: I/System.out(1609):     _id INTEGER PRIMARY KEY AUTOINCREMENT, 
12-31 23:21:15.535: I/System.out(1609):     suggest_text_1 VARCHAR(100),
12-31 23:21:15.535: I/System.out(1609):     test_value_1 VARCHAR(100),
12-31 23:21:15.535: I/System.out(1609):     test_value_2 VARCHAR(100),
12-31 23:21:15.535: I/System.out(1609):     test_type_1 VARCHAR(50),
12-31 23:21:15.535: I/System.out(1609):     suggest_intent_data VARCHAR(5))
12-31 23:21:15.545: I/System.out(1609): INSERT INTO la_table VALUES(1,"Sodium (Na)","310 - 330 mg/dl",null,“Serum”,"1")
12-31 23:21:15.545: I/SqliteDatabaseCpp(1609): sqlite returned: error code = 1, msg = no such column: “Serum”, db=/data/data/com.assistant.lab.royale/databases/la_db